Output 554ccbc113bf9576f88258fa597b74d8b9b7e6614baf2230b1ad7c5dde17a577:2

value
1026285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e3c3f3f2264669eea089c590a5bf0647a0efee0 OP_EQUAL
address
32zHZGWnvhpGDhLHBNBRgguXkpLb9vCakU
transaction
554ccbc113bf9576f88258fa597b74d8b9b7e6614baf2230b1ad7c5dde17a577
spent
true